Healthy White Chicken Chili Recipe

This Healthy White Chicken Chili recipe is a nutritious, flavorful dish made with lean chicken breast, white beans, and a blend of spices. Perfect for a cozy dinner, it's easy to prepare and loaded with protein, fiber, and essential nutrients. The chili is both hearty and satisfying, making it an excellent choice for a family meal or meal prep.

Ingredients

  • 1 lb chicken breast, diced
  • 2 cans (15 oz each) white beans, drained and rinsed
  • 1 medium onion, diced
  • 3 garlic cloves, minced
  • 2 cups low-sodium chicken broth
  • 1 cup corn kernels
  • 1 can (4 oz) diced green chilies
  • 1 tsp ground cumin
  • 1 tsp chili powder
  • 1/2 tsp oregano
  • 1/4 tsp cayenne pepper (optional)
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1/2 cup plain Greek yogurt (for serving)
  • Fresh cilantro and lime wedges for garnish

Instructions

  •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add diced onion and sauté until softened, about 5 minutes.
  • Add minced garlic and cook for another minute.
  • Stir in diced chicken breast, cumin, chili powder, oregano, and cayenne pepper. Cook until the chicken is browned on all sides.
  • Add the white beans, corn, green chilies, and chicken broth.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for 20 minutes.
  •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  • Serve hot, topped with Greek yogurt, fresh cilantro, and lime wedges.

Notes

  • For added creaminess, you can blend a portion of the chili and stir it back into the pot.
  • This recipe can be made ahead and stored in the refrigerator for up to 4 days or frozen for up to 3 months.
  • Adjust the spice level by adding more or less cayenne pepper.
